## Deployment

TileCrate runs as a sidecar to the render fleet in the Orvano region. Support: do not restart it during peak hours; cold cache means slow map loads for ~20 minutes. Deploys go through the Lanternfall pipeline only. Rollbacks are safe; cache survives. If a customer reports stale tiles, check eviction first. Current production settings are listed here.

deployment values, tafof-taduf:
pelius:
  pin: 6508
  tenant: praiel
  seal: seal_4e33a2f4
  metrics_host: metrics.pelius.plorvagrid.corp
  standby_team: druix
  escalation: juldor-norius
  nonce: 5db598

Test plan — PickPath optimizer, Larkwell depot sandbox.

Scope: verify batch sizes 10/50/200, aisle-conflict resolution, and fallback ordering when the optimizer times out. Expect sub-400ms solve times; flag anything over 1s. Re-run nightly until release cut. All optimizer API calls in the sandbox require auth; use the bearer token below.

login token, bagug-kafop: eyJhbGciOiJIUzI1NiIsInR5cCI6IkpXVCJ9.eyJzdWIiOiIcMLov2In0.Z5RLDIfp

TURN-208: Gatevale turnstile counters at the Merrow Field pilot double-count when a rotation reverses mid-cycle. Attendance totals drift roughly 2% high per event. The debounce window fix is implemented, reviewed by Ilsa, and soak-tested across two simulated match days without drift. Ready for your cut; the candidate build is identified below.

trace token, tagag-tafog: htk6_5ed18c